Nutritional Benefits Tailored for Athletes
Preworkout chocolate bars are not just any chocolate bars; they are specially formulated with ingredients intended to increase endurance, energy, and focus. The bars often contain a blend of carbohydrates, proteins, and fats in well-balanced proportions, ensuring a sustained release of energy throughout the workout. Additionally, ingredients such as caffeine, beta-alanine, creatine, and BCAAs (Branched-chain amino acids) are common in these bars, providing the added stimulus required for a more intense and focused training session.

The Science Behind the Sweetness
The effectiveness of preworkout chocolate bars is rooted in their composition. Dark chocolate, which is often a primary ingredient in these bars, naturally contains a small amount of caffeine and is rich in flavonoids, antioxidants that have been linked to improved blood flow and reduced muscle fatigue. The incorporation of additional performance-enhancing ingredients like L-theanine can also help mitigate the jittery side effects of caffeine, promoting a more stable and focused state of mind during exercise.
Understanding the Right Dosage and Timing
For preworkout chocolate bars to be effective, they must be consumed with the correct dosage and timing in mind. Most products recommend eating the chocolate bar 30 minutes to an hour before beginning a workout, allowing enough time for the body to process the ingredients and convert them into usable energy. It's also crucial for consumers to pay attention to the serving size and the amount of active ingredients to avoid overconsumption, which can lead to negative side effects such as upset stomach or overstimulation.
